PATNA HIGH COURT
Purnendu Singh, J
Jeetendra Kumar Singh – Appellant
Versus
The State of Bihar through the Principal Secretary, Rural Development Department, Govt. of Bihar, Patna – Respondent
Civil Writ Jurisdiction Case No.12566 of 2021

CORAM: HONOURABLE MR. JUSTICE PURNENDU SINGH ORAL ORDER
3 31-01-2026 Heard learned counsel appearing on behalf of the petitioner and learned APP for the State.
2. The petitioner in paragraph no. 1 of the present writ petition has sought, inter alia, the following relief(s), which is reproduced hereinafter:-
“1. That this writ application is being filed for issuance of writ nature of mandamus to direction respondent consider in the application of the petitioner filed on 06.02.2017 and 16.09.2017, same is still pending for due consideration and further issue direction to the respondents District Magistrate to consider the application and disposed of by the speaking order and further give other legal consequential benefit to the petitioner.”
3. Learned counsel appearing on behalf of the petitioner submitted the the petitioner seeks to avail remedy against order dated 12.01.2007 and he has already filed representation for the same on 06.02.2017 and 16.09.2017 but the same has not been entertain till date and the required information has already been brought on record by way of Annexure 2 and 5 respectively.
4. Considering the aforesaid submission and the relief(s) as sought for in the present writ petition the petitioner having aggrieved by the order dated 12.01.2007 may avail remedy before the appropriate authority on the basis of development which has taken place during the pendency of the writ petition in accordance with law.
5. The District Magistrate – cum – Collector must also ensure that he keep himself vigilant in respect of the functioning of the circle office. In the present case the name is required to be verified of those Circle Officers of East Champaran, who were holding the post during the period the order was passed and such communication is required to be made to the Additional Chief Secretary, Revenue and Land Reforms Department, as well as, the General Administration Department for taking appropriate action for harassing the poor citizen and forcing him to file the present writ petition.
6. Accordingly, the present application stands disposed of.
